    Beyond the Classroom: Resources and Opportunities at Ohio State

    Let's talk about some specific resources and opportunities available to international studies students at Ohio State. One of the most important is the university's many centers and institutes focused on different regions of the world. For example, Ohio State has the Center for African Studies, the East Asian Studies Center, and the Center for Slavic and East European Studies, among others. These centers offer courses, research opportunities, and events related to their respective regions. They're a great place to deepen your knowledge of a specific part of the world. Another excellent resource is the university's career services. They can help you with resume writing, interviewing skills, and finding internships and jobs related to international studies. Career services is there to help you succeed. They offer advice that helps you find your path. Don't be afraid to ask for help! Another great option is the Undergraduate Research Office. They can help you find research opportunities with faculty members. Participating in research is a great way to gain experience. Also, consider the university's Global Gateway. These are international centers located in different countries. They provide resources for students studying abroad. These resources include language courses, cultural immersion programs, and opportunities for networking.
